Kountouris Surname Meaning
The Greek surname Kountouris (Κουντούρης) is a patronymic and descriptive surname derived from the adjective kountourós (κοντουρός), meaning “short,” “stocky,” or “compact.” It originally functioned as a physical nickname assigned to an ancestor distinguished by build or stature, a common practice in traditional Greek communities where such traits were used for everyday identification. In some regions, the name also appeared as a personal byname before becoming hereditary. As surnames stabilized, the descriptive reference softened while the family name remained fixed. Consequently, the surname Kountouris signifies “the descendant of the stocky or short one,” reflecting descriptive origin rather than occupation.
